What is an EMD Piston Ring?
EMD (Electro-Motive Diesel) is a globally recognized manufacturer of diesel engines, especially for locomotives and industrial applications. An EMD piston ring is a precision-engineered ring that fits around the piston inside an EMD engine cylinder. Its main role is to create a seal between the piston and cylinder wall, allowing optimal combustion pressure while minimizing oil leakage.
Key Functions of EMD Piston Rings
Sealing the Combustion Chamber: Prevents combustion gases from leaking into the crankcase.
Heat Transfer: Helps transfer heat from the piston to the cylinder wall.
Oil Control: Regulates oil film thickness to avoid excessive oil consumption.
Pressure Regulation: Maintains consistent compression levels for efficient engine operation.
Types of EMD Piston Rings
There are different types of EMD piston rings depending on their function:
Compression Rings: Maintain combustion pressure and prevent gas leakage.
Oil Control Rings: Manage oil distribution along the cylinder wall.
Scraper Rings: Remove excess oil from the cylinder surface.

Why Quality Matters in EMD Piston Rings
High-quality EMD piston rings are manufactured with precise tolerances and superior materials like cast iron alloys, steel, or chromium coatings. Poor-quality rings may lead to:
Increased oil consumption
Loss of compression
Engine overheating
Reduced engine life

Applications of EMD Piston Rings
EMD piston rings are widely used in:
Locomotive Engines: EMD SD40, SD70 series, and other models.
Marine Engines: Tugboats, ferries, and cargo ships.
Power Generation: Backup diesel generators for industrial plants.
Oil & Gas Industry: Onshore and offshore diesel-powered equipment.
